No module named bluepy

See original GitHub issue

Hi all, i’m attempting to run bt-mqtt-gateway to detect some NUT beacons but when i execute the command “sudo ./gateway.py” e get this error

22:11:38 Starting
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"./gateway.py", line 67, in <module>
    manager.register_workers(global_topic_prefix).start(mqtt)
  File "/home/pi/bt-mqtt-gateway/workers_manager.py", line 81, in register_workers
    module_obj = importlib.import_module("workers.%s" % worker_name)
  File "/usr/lib/python3.7/importlib/__init__.py", line 127, in import_module
    return _bootstrap._gcd_import(name[level:], package, level)
  File "<frozen importlib._bootstrap>", line 1006, in _gcd_import
  File "<frozen importlib._bootstrap>", line 983, in _find_and_load
  File "<frozen importlib._bootstrap>", line 967, in _find_and_load_unlocked
  File "<frozen importlib._bootstrap>", line 677, in _load_unlocked
  File "<frozen importlib._bootstrap_external>", line 728, in exec_module
  File "<frozen importlib._bootstrap>", line 219, in _call_with_frames_removed
  File "/home/pi/bt-mqtt-gateway/workers/blescanmulti.py", line 3, in <module>
    from bluepy.btle import Scanner, DefaultDelegate
ModuleNotFoundError: No module named 'bluepy'

what i can do? Thanks

pip3 install bluepy

Are you running it in a Python virtual environment? If so, you might need to install it inside there.
